Slate roof construction services involve the installation of durable, natural slate tiles on residential or commercial properties. This process includes preparing the roof structure, selecting quality slate materials, and carefully fitting each tile to ensure a secure and long-lasting roof. Skilled contractors focus on precision to achieve a visually appealing finish while maintaining the integrity of the roof, which can add a classic or upscale look to a property. Proper installation is essential to maximize the lifespan of a slate roof and to prevent issues such as leaks or tile damage over time.
This service helps address common problems associated with aging or poorly constructed roofs. For example, slate roofs are highly resistant to rot, mold, and insect damage, making them an excellent choice for properties prone to moisture issues. However, over time, slate tiles can crack or become loose, leading to leaks or water infiltration. Replacing damaged tiles or installing a new slate roof can restore the roof’s protective barrier, prevent water damage to the underlying structure, and maintain the property's value. Slate roof construction is often chosen for properties that seek an elegant, timeless appearance, including historic homes, upscale residences, and certain commercial buildings. These roofs are especially popular in areas where durability and aesthetic appeal are priorities. Homes with steep or complex rooflines may benefit from the versatility of slate tiles, which can be cut and shaped to fit various architectural styles. Additionally, properties in regions with significant weather variations may find slate roofs advantageous due to their resistance to wind, rain, and snow, providing reliable protection for many years.

The overview below groups typical Slate Roof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in West Linn, OR.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or slate roof repairs in West Linn range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.
Partial Repairs - For more extensive patching or replacing sections of slate,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Projects in this range are common for homeowners addressing multiple damaged areas.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ete slate roof replacements in the West Linn area usually cost between $10,000 and $25,000. Larger, more complex jobs can exceed this range, especially for custom or high-end materials.
Major or Complex Projects - Larger, more intricate slate roofing projects, such as redesigns or extensive restorations, can reach $30,000 or more. These projects are less frequent but are handled by local pros with specialized experience.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
